The size of Wilyabrup is approximately 81.7 square kilometres. It has 5 parks covering nearly 20.4% of total area. The population of Wilyabrup in 2016 was 180 people. By 2021 the population was 193 showing a population growth of 7.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Wilyabrup is 40-49 years. Households in Wilyabrup are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Wilyabrup work in a managers occupation.In 2021, 59.40% of the homes in Wilyabrup were owner-occupied compared with 60.40% in 2016.
